Los Suaves - San Francisco Express (1997)

Outstanding concept album about death, with the train used as a metaphor of one’s trip to the cemetery of San Francisco (in Ourense, Spain), which is the final destination. Most of the songs describe different characters and their sad existence.

The band were always influenced by Thin Lizzy and had great poetic lyrics, but this album is heavier. A masterpiece.
 
Edguy - Vain Glory Opera


A textbook on how to write catchy (power) metal. Stratovarius vibe in the epic-sounding intro, galloping verses, one of the most memorable choir-like choruses, solid riffing, cool solo. Overall a classic song.
